Somewhere in between Nature Morte and landscape paintings, "By the forest" explores how AI can be utilized simply as another tool in a modern day artist's palette. Pictures taken from Scheer's recent trip to Marseille & Paris are being combined with AI-generated images, reworked with digital tools in a post-production process, and finally photographed by a Polaroid camera. In this scenario, AI can be seen as one of the co-creators, among many others, of the piece.

    About the artist

    Aaron Scheer (*1990) is a Berlin-based artist, known for utilizing the digital realm to expand
    what painting can be and mean today by combining elements of photography, collage, sculpture and painterly technique. Scheer’s work has been widely shown internationally at, among others, Kunstmuseum Bonn, Kunsthalle Düsseldorf, MODEM, MoCDA, The Wrong Biennale, KÖNIG GALERIE, Boros Foundation, Annka Kultys Gallery, OFFICE IMPART, Enter Art Fair, Sunday Art Fair, Art Brussels, isthisit or Offsite Project. His works are part of notable collections such as Sammlung Wemhöner and Kunstmuseum Bonn. He is part of the international art collective darktaxa-project.
